A 19th Century Breathtaking French Savanneri tug Color:Burgundy DO NOT bid on thisIn a former Parisian soap factory known as the Savonnerie young orphans worked alongside artisan carpet weavers producing knotted pile rugs for the crown rulers palaces. Savonnerie carpets enjoyed tremendous popularity throughout the 17th century. In 1608 Henry IV better known as Henry the great commissioned DuPont and his apprentice Simon Lourdes to produce carpets from a workshop in the Louvre the weaving team quickly outgrew the Louvre studio
